    Summer in the Hop Yard 2017

    Summertime at Karridale Cottages and Hop Farm is spent outdoors enjoying the beautiful weather, peaceful bush lands, gorgeous beaches and the serenity of the Blackwood River. Whilst guests are busy exploring the surrounds we at Karridale Hop Farm are busy working hard making sure our hops will be ready for harvest from February through to late March.

     

     

    Much time is spent throughout the summer strolling through the hop yard winding young tender hop shoots up the drop strings that the bines will eventually use to grow towards our cross-wires. After a successful winter digging up rhizomes, splitting and transplanting them, we are seeing some wonderful first year growth in our expansion bays. We have been busy in the workshop as well designing and building our own hop dryer for what we believe will deliver a superior dried product. We can't wait to put it to the test with this years harvest.

     

     

    With 13 varieties growing well, we are excited once again for the harvest season to get to work alongside local brewers to create regionally distinct beers using the freshest of ingredients. At the end of January we harvested one of our early varieties, Pemberton " Wild Blend", which has quickly become our strongest hop variety and with true wild abandon the first hops to reach the drop lines and to set cones. We're excited about the possibility of working with Jarrah Jacks Brewery in Pemberton to showcase these locally grown, heritage hops in a beer they were destined to be a part of.

     

    We continue to monitor the other hop varieties including Cascade, Chinook, Flinders, Nugget, and Perle in anticipation of a March harvest. We’re keen to once again to provide local breweries with some fresh "wet-hops" to celebrate the season! Please look out for further information about beer releases in the very near future.
